
window.open导致localStorage数据丢失的排查指南
使用window.open在新标签页打开同源页面后,发现localStorage中的token丢失,这可能是以下原因导致的:
一、非同源问题:
请仔细检查新打开页面的URL与原始页面URL的域名和协议是否完全一致。 不同源的页面之间无法共享localStorage数据。
二、代码中意外删除:
检查新页面代码,确认是否意外删除或覆盖了localStorage中的token属性。 在同源确认后,仔细检查相关代码,排查是否存在此类操作。
如果以上两点都排查无误,问题仍然存在,请提供更多代码细节,以便更精准地定位问题根源。
以上就是使用window.open打开新页面后,localStorage中的token丢失了怎么办?的详细内容,更多请关注创想鸟其它相关文章!
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/1502568.html
微信扫一扫
支付宝扫一扫